Understanding Low-VOC Paints



When you select low-VOC paints, you're selecting a product that releases less unstable natural compounds, which can be damaging to both your health and wellness and the setting.


VOCs are chemicals located in many paint products that can vaporize into the air and contribute to interior air contamination. By choosing low-VOC options, you're reducing the number of these emissions, making your space safer.

Low-VOC paints commonly have 50 grams per liter or fewer VOCs, contrasted to standard paints that can have approximately 250 grams per litre. This means that when you paint your home with low-VOC items, you're not just making a choice for aesthetic appeals; you're likewise taking a step in the direction of a much healthier indoor atmosphere.

These paints are available in a range of coatings and shades, so you will not have to jeopardize on design. They're suitable for both interior and exterior jobs, offering longevity and insurance coverage like their standard equivalents.

And also, several makers are now focusing on developing low-VOC formulations without giving up efficiency. Recognizing low-VOC paints empowers you to make educated selections for your home and well-being while adding to ecological preservation.

Potential Downsides to Consider



While low-VOC paints offer numerous advantages, there are some possible drawbacks to bear in mind. house painting costs near me is their performance contrasted to conventional paints. Low-VOC alternatives may not constantly offer the same level of durability and insurance coverage, which can lead to more frequent touch-ups or a requirement for extra layers. This can be aggravating and taxing throughout your painting task.

One more problem is the drying out time. Low-VOC paints typically take longer to dry than their high-VOC equivalents, which can extend your task timeline. If you're on a limited routine, this could be a disadvantage to take into consideration.

You ought to also know that low-VOC paints can often have a different finish or appearance. If you're going for a particular aesthetic, ensure to check examples to make sure the outcome meets your expectations.

Finally, while low-VOC paints are normally more secure, they can still send out some fumes. Proper air flow is vital during and after application, so be prepared to air out your room successfully.
